A Bikram yoga mat or a variation of it is a must if you are into Bikram yoga or hot yoga of any kind. The end result of hot yoga of any kind is a lot of inspiration. Did I mention that sweat is everywhere? So a regular mat, in these situations, probably won’t work unless you don’t mind slipping and sliding. What needs to be in place is something that gives you traction combined with absorption. Enter the Bikram Yoga Mat and Bikram Yoga Towel.

There are three main options available to solve the dilemma of sweat and traction together in one. They range from super simple and cheap to just buying a tool for exactly the job, which is a great way to figure things out. 😉 Option 1: Use a towel with your regular yoga mat. Well, you probably didn’t need to read this to know, but really a towel will do the trick. It will keep all the sweat in check, but when it comes to traction, just be careful because the towel doesn’t give you the traction you need for the poses. So you can’t practice with it, you can only use it together with your yoga mat. Option 2 – Use a proper Bikram yoga mat towel. These nifty little things are much thinner. They look like micro fiber and are around $20 and up. You place it on your mat and voila, you can practice on it and use it to remove moisture. Option 3: This is also obvious, but some people don’t know it, and that is to buy a specific mat for Bikram Yoga. These mats are sticky on the bottom and soft but absorbent on top! Well now this sounds like what we’re looking for! The only thing is, they can be hard to come by.

Bikram Yoga mats, though hard to come by, are the best option available if you strictly practice this style of yoga. They are specific to control sweat and traction in one. They have 3 main qualities to them, not too different from regular yoga but slightly varied. The bottom is sticky so the mat stays in place, the main part of the mat is designed for cushioning and then the top layer is definitely for sweat wicking. These full meal deals can often be machine washed and tumble dried which is really easy to maintain compared to other yoga mats out there. Prices you can expect to pay $60 and up for a Bikram yoga mat. Shop around and online is really the best place to start.

There are a few other options out there to cover your Bikram yoga needs. There are cotton yoga mats out there that are apparently pretty good in these kinds of conditions. And their history bears this out as well, as they have been used longer than anything else on the market, and in places like India and abroad. Cotton yoga mats are woven. They offer good cushioning combined with good traction. Once there is a little bit of moisture, your hands and feet will stick very well.
